Aviation lubricants are used to enhance engine efficiency by decreasing friction between two surfaces, which leads to additional kilometers of the same quantity of gas.The maintenance and conditioning of aircraft components such as turbine, motors, airframe and bearings are a key factor for aviation lubricants.
In the aviation sector, an aircraft’s parts are often subjected during its locomotion to elevated temperature, pressure, impact changes and loads.Using extremely effective and field-tested aviation lubricant can improve the aircraft component’s operational lifetime and further decrease its cost of repair and maintenance.Prominent reasons behind the use of aviation lubricant are that the place of failure in the aviation sector is hard to rectify and repair.
Air Lubricants Market Technology is an important area for regions such as MEA, North America and Europe.Due to the existence of significant business and military aircraft main players such as Boeing and Lockheed Martin, North America is considered to lead the global aviation lubricant industry. The region has the world’s largest aircraft fleet, increasing demand for lubricant aviation products. On the other hand, Asia Pacific is expected to contribute for a major market share in the year 2020 owing to presence of economies such as China and India.
The main players in the aviation lubricants industry are constantly strengthening the use of aviation lubricants in particular, commercial, army and corporate aviation. Market players are promoting the future possibilities of the aviation lubricants market through the inclination towards sustainable solutions in the aerospace lubrication industry.The marketing of viable aviation is anticipated to lead to future opportunities for the aerospace lubricants industry through collaborative approaches such as the one seen this year between Shell Aviation and Sky NRG.
